The MACS Facelift Procedure

The MACS facelift is a minimally invasive procedure that targets the lower third of the face, including the neck, jowls, and jawline. Unlike a traditional facelift, the MACS technique uses smaller incisions and a specialized technique to lift and tighten the underlying facial muscles and tissue. This results in a more natural-looking, rejuvenated appearance without the extensive scarring and longer recovery time associated with a traditional facelift.

Healing Time and Recovery

The healing process after a MACS facelift can vary from patient to patient, but generally, you can expect the following timeline: 1. Immediate Post-Op: Immediately after the procedure, you can expect some swelling, bruising, and discomfort. Your surgeon will provide you with pain medication to help manage any discomfort. 2. First Week: During the first week, the swelling and bruising will be at their peak. You may need to wear a compression garment to help minimize swelling and support the treated areas. Most patients are able to return to light, non-strenuous activities within the first week. 3. Two to Three Weeks: The majority of the swelling and bruising should subside within two to three weeks, allowing you to return to your normal daily activities, including work. However, you may still experience some residual swelling and sensitivity in the treated areas. 4. One to Two Months: Over the course of one to two months, the final results of the MACS facelift will become more evident as the swelling continues to diminish, and the skin and underlying tissues settle into their new, rejuvenated position. It's important to note that the healing process can vary depending on factors such as your age, skin type, and overall health. Your surgeon will provide you with specific instructions and a personalized timeline for your recovery.

Choosing a Qualified Surgeon in Dallas

When considering a MACS facelift in Dallas, it's crucial to choose a qualified and experienced plastic surgeon. Look for a board-certified plastic surgeon with a proven track record of successful MACS facelift procedures. During your consultation, be sure to ask about the surgeon's qualifications, including: - Board certification in plastic surgery - Years of experience performing MACS facelifts - Specialized training and techniques in facial rejuvenation - Before-and-after photos of previous MACS facelift patients A skilled and reputable surgeon will be able to guide you through the entire process, from the initial consultation to the final results, and ensure a safe and successful outcome.

FAQ

**How long does a MACS facelift last?** A MACS facelift can provide long-lasting results, with many patients enjoying the benefits for 7-10 years or even longer, depending on the individual's skin elasticity and aging process. **Is a MACS facelift safer than a traditional facelift?** Yes, the MACS facelift is generally considered a safer and less invasive procedure compared to a traditional facelift. The smaller incisions and specialized techniques used in a MACS facelift result in a lower risk of complications and a quicker recovery time. **Can I combine a MACS facelift with other procedures?** Yes, many patients choose to combine a MACS facelift with other facial rejuvenation procedures, such as blepharoplasty (eyelid surgery) or a brow lift, to achieve a more comprehensive transformation.
